On Feb 11 I was contacted by phone by a company selling a real estate foreclosure program. After a long talk with the gentleman on the phone to decided if my husband and I were qualified to be part of their success team. I purchased a real estate program through your company. It included Real Estate Property pro software, Claude Diamond's How to control real estate (seminar dvd). Simple Investment Strategies, Real Estate E-Learning by netcoach.com, and Tax Vantage 4.0 software. I had made it clear that I wanted to set this up as a business and not run it through my personal accounts. I was told that this would not be a problem.

Near the end of June, I contacted PMI to discuss a refund, I was told that the product I purchased was through NMR and when I contacted NMR they told me that I had actually purchased the product the a company called Summit Consulting. I tried contacting Summit Consulting and on July 17, I called and spoke with Mr. Erik Largin. Up until this time no one had returned any of my calls. I informed him that I was not happy with the program and I wanted a refund. He told me that he would speak with Mr. Jordan Mathena and get back with me. Erik did not call me back. On the 21st, I called Erik and was told that I needed to speak with a Mr. Jim Cochran. I contacted Mr. Cochran, who offered me more coaching. I told him that I did not want more coaching, that the program did not work. He then informed me that our conversation was being recorded. I understand that Utah is a one-party state but Pennsylvania is not. The FCC requires that notification be given before the recording takes place (not during or after). Mr. Cochran's last statement to me was Some people make money, Others make excuses. Mr. Largin will tell you that the only reason I am seeking a refund is because I quit my job and need the money. If the program worked as promised, I would be working; buying and selling real estate.

As to my complaints about this program:
1) Tax Vantage software does not track any thing, but does promote using the tax club.

2) The coaching consisted of being told the same things that were on the netcoach dvd.

3) I was promised that financing could be found. It couldn't.

4) I was promised that I would make back my initial investment in 60-90 days. Which did not happen.

5) I was told that I could not fail. I would be your next infomercial success story.

6) I was not told about the cost of setting up an LLC until after I had purchased the program. I had explained from the very beginning that I wanted this done as a company, not as an individual as I wanted to protect my assets.

7) I was not told the name of the company I was working with until I decided that this program did not work and was seeking a refund. The name on the billing is PMI yet I am told that I purchased through Summit Consulting.

8) When I called PMI a second time, I was told that the company I had called was mynetbiz. Thinking I had called a wrong number I redialed and was informed that I had reached mynetbiz. They gave me the new number to PMI. Although I was not working with mynetbiz, they could pull up all my information up on their computer. Why would a company that I am not working with be able to pull up my information? Why do they even have access to it?

I have been in contact with the Tax Club and they have agreed to a full refund. I have also been in contact with the Advantage Corporation Services in Nevada.

After seeking advice on this situation, I have been told that since PMI is the company that took my money, they should be the ones that I contact first with my complaint. I have also been advised that it is my consumer right to file complaints with state and federal regulatory and law enforcement groups.

Nothing that was promised has been delivered. I do not wish to continue with this program, I do not want to try another program. I do not want more coaching. I feel that I have been deceived by the company or companies involved. I can not trust a company that would not divulge its true name to me and does not deliver on its promises.

I am requesting a full refund of $7179.00.
